## Changelog — Papermint Renderer v4.2.0

This release changes several defaults in the Papermint PDF invoice renderer that have security implications. External font fetching is now disabled by default, embedded JavaScript in templates is stripped rather than warned on, and the sandbox profile tightened to deny all outbound network calls during render. Operators relying on the old behavior must opt in explicitly. Please review each change carefully, as silent upgrades will alter output. The complete new default configuration is reproduced below.

service settings:
[casax]
port = 6379
team = rusir
host = casax.zemvarhq.corp
region = outer-4
access_code = ac_9808ce
timeout_ms = 1500

## Changelog 5.2.0 — Key Rotation

Rotated the signing key used by Strata, our incremental static site rebuild tool. The old key expires at end of month; builds signed with it will still verify until then. Incremental rebuild behavior is unchanged: only pages whose content hashes differ are regenerated, and the manifest is re-signed on every partial build. Reviewers should confirm the CI config references the new key before approving. For reference, the new signing key is included below.

rollout seal: bky4_x7Gc

## Limits & Quotas

Quick reference for anyone on call during the Tidemark consent banner rollout. We cap banner config fetches per region and throttle the rollout percentage bumps so a bad config can't hit everyone at once. Page the rollout owner before raising anything. Current limits are set as follows.

tuning table, hafog-bahaf:
QUOTAS = {
    "praion": 144,
    "briax": 906,
    "silwyn": 451,
}